Radians and Revolutions
Radians are a unit of angular measure used in mathematics, where one full revolution (360 degrees) is equal to 2π radians. Understanding the relationship between radians and revolutions is crucial for converting angular velocity from radians per second to revolutions per minute.

Angular Velocity
Angular velocity is a measure of how quickly an object rotates or moves around a central point, typically expressed in radians per second. In this context, the angular velocity of the searchlight beam is given as -0.6 rad/sec, indicating the rate at which the beam sweeps across the shore.

Conversion of Units
Converting units is a fundamental skill in calculus and physics, allowing for the translation of measurements from one system to another. To find revolutions per minute from radians per second, one must apply conversion factors, specifically recognizing that 1 revolution equals 2π radians and there are 60 seconds in a minute.
